Polar molecular solids are _________(a) bad conductors of electricity(b) good conductors of electricity(c) solid at room temperature(d) brittleI got this question in homework.This intriguing question comes from Classification of Crystalline Solids topic in section Solid State of Chemistry – Class 12

Answer»

The CORRECT option is (a) BAD conductors of ELECTRICITY

Best explanation: In polar MOLECULAR solids, the molecules are formed by covalent bonds and held together by strong dipole-dipole interaction. Therefore, polar molecular solids are non-conductors of electricity.
